Big Surf Island Screenshots Smash In!

By | December 1, 2008 | DLC, Xbox 360 |

It’s been a while since we posted an update from the Criterion Games team, but they’ve been hard at work.  Now with all the major game releases over with, we’re finally going to get a small lull and time to recoup some cash in our wallets.  Let’s get to the news then.  Criterion Games has posted new screenshots of the Burnout Paradise Island DLC they’ve been promising.  From what I can see, it looks pretty good and more importantly, really really fun.  So without further adieu, here are the screenshots.  I’ll do my best to explain them below according to what Criterion said about them.

First, the image of the 4 Dust Storms. Those are new dune buggies that are coming when this DLC hits.  The image itself shows off what Burnout Paradise is really about: getting together with your friends and just having fun.  Have you played in the Airfield or the Quarry in Burnout Paradise? Well now take that fun concept, and think the size of Downtown Paradise City with all that fun!  Yes, you can jump through all of those hoops and that construction building in the background can also be accessed to the top floor.

Next up, is the image with the palm trees.  This shows off some of the new foliage coming to Burnout Paradise, as well as the more “tropical” side of the island.  It also has some off road driving to satisfy everyone’s rallying fix.  And see that jump right before the tower? You guessed it; you can jump through that.

Construction, a big glass building and a view of the bridge from the island is the next screenshot.  This screenshot was taken to show off what the bridge looks like from the island and to emphasize the “if you can see it, you can drive it” mantra of the Burnout Team.  You can even get up to the top of that scaffolding; how cool is that?!

Finally, the last screenshot is of the entrance to the island. You can see the big Big Surf Island banner as well as two towers.  The one on the left is a parking garage and it is said you can Drift all the way up it and all the way down it.  The other, known as the Taylor J Towers, got their name from DBC9MX, who won the Downtown Showtime Showdown competition, and named the building after his son, Taylor J.
